Try some mods, you'll love them. I suggest:
Snaking - which is exactly letting you "expand your city outward" to build logging camps and piers.
River Bridge City - Allows a wonderful bridge which lets you "expand" your city to the other side of a river and keep building.
You might try my Mythic Buildings Packs if you want buildings that will reduce "bad starts". They give wargs, horses, metal, essence and other things, nicely balanced.
Transmutation Spell Pack lets you convert mana into resources like Crystal or Horses.
One more thing you can do is build a sovereign around a theme. Path of the Mage + Warlock + Enchanters + Quick Empire + Armorer... oh yeah. Another good one is Altarian Blood with all the EXP increase perks. By specializing in this way, you can overcome a bad economy in the early game.
